Discovery of Point Mutations in the Voltage-Gated Sodium Channel from African Aedes aegypti Populations: Potential Phylogenetic Reasons for Gene Introgression

Abstract: BackgroundYellow fever is endemic in some countries in Africa, and Aedes aegpyti is one of the most important vectors implicated in the outbreak. The mapping of the nation-wide distribution and the detection of insecticide resistance of vector mosquitoes will provide the beneficial information for forecasting of dengue and yellow fever outbreaks and effective control measures.Methodology/Principal FindingsHigh resistance to DDT was observed in all mosquito colonies collected in Ghana. “…The vast majority of studies of resistance mechanisms in Ae. aegypti are from The Americas and Asia [19, 25, 26], though a recent first study from West Africa identified the presence of target site resistance shared with American populations [27]. Knowledge of resistance mechanisms in the Middle East and their relationship with other regions is currently lacking.…”

“…Instead, mutation V1016I was found, and often coexists with F1534C in South and North America, such as Venezuela [48], three French overseas territories [49], Brazil [50,51,52], Mexico [53], and the USA [54]. More recently, V1016I and F1534C were detected in Ghana, Africa [55], and a new mutation, T1520I, was found along with the F1534C mutation in a population in India [56]. …”
